Team — rotating credentials for Pulsegrid's internal health-check probe today. The probe sits behind the Farwick load balancer and hits /healthz on each backend every 10s; unauthenticated probes get 401 and the node gets drained, so don't skip this. Old key dies at 17:00. Update the probe config on all three nodes, restart the agent, confirm green status in the Pulsegrid dashboard before you leave. Ping the infra channel if a node flaps. The new key for the probe service is below.

gateway credential: kto3_qfe

## Changelog — Resolvo 2.9

Changed DNS resolution defaults. Background: intermittent lookup failures in the batch tier traced to a single upstream resolver timing out under load. Fix: retries now rotate across resolvers instead of hammering one, timeout lowered, negative caching disabled by default. New team members: this is why old runbooks mention "flaky DNS" — it should no longer apply. If you see NXDOMAIN storms post-upgrade, check overrides before escalating. Defaults shipped with this release are listed below.

config for kafof-bawef:
holath:
  log_level: debug
  metrics_host: metrics.holath.qorvelsys.internal
  pin: 2191
  pool_size: 32

Q: A customer says points vanished from their balance — what do I check first? A: Open the Pebblepoint loyalty ledger and pull the member's transaction trail; every accrual, redemption, and expiry is recorded as an immutable entry, so nothing truly disappears. Most cases are scheduled expirations the customer missed. If the trail itself looks incomplete, escalate to the ledger team rather than adjusting manually. To open the sealed audit view, enter the passphrase provided just below.

vault phrase of hahop-badug = novvan-ulaion-zorius-noviel-gorwyn-casix-tamys

Subject: Handover — Ledgerline user module split. Hi, taking over release duty from me this week means watching the extraction of the user module from the Ledgerline monolith. Phase two ships Thursday; the new user-service artifacts deploy through the Marrow pipeline. Pipeline uploads are rejected unless signed, so you'll need the deploy key that follows.

signing key of tajeg-bahip = bky13_Z1v9yta8m8YjC